As the largest in Australia, Kakadu National Park is the big daddy when it comes to exploring this vast land’s natural wilderness. Situated in the Northern Territory, a few hours’ drive from Darwin, the park is a steamy tropical mix of wetlands and floodplains, escarpments and gorges. It’s also an important UNESCO site, one […]
